Output f324ce660872eb71e8a8a9c6ede2daec4a1da0604551a0b20fc28ae184debdab:0

value
6606072920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81b2505dc3ca22f77768b506038a0421fec8b97 OP_EQUAL
address
3MPgQ28zRMPsLz8PHsCZuwxz89Uh6CuHy3
transaction
f324ce660872eb71e8a8a9c6ede2daec4a1da0604551a0b20fc28ae184debdab
spent
true